Google Adwords Quality Score Explained

Note on quality score: Google (Google Adwords) states quality score is not used at time of auction when placing ads however Google defines quality score as: “an estimate of the quality of your ads, keywords, and landing pages. Higher quality ads can lead to lower prices and better ad positions.” We find that quality score indirectly affects ad cost and has a huge impact on the overall cost to advertise. Higher quality score = lower cost/click.  The below numbers and figures are estimates and information should be used as a general guide to better help you understand how Google ranks websites on search engines.

Google Adwords quality score is extremely important when advertising.  Simply put, the lower the quality score the more you pay to advertise and the higher the quality score the less you pay and more customers you’ll have.

Google and other search engines rank ads placed from 1-10 (quality score).  Google considers 5 a good ranking however we strive for ranking scores from 7-10 allowing us to show up in the top of Google search results for a fraction of the cost.  We do not run ads on Google under a 6 rating.  Most of the ads we run are ranked 7-10 quality score allowing us to pass savings to our customers

Adwords Quality Score x $$$ = Ranking Score

Ranking score determines who shows up 1st, 2nd, 3rd etc on Google Search

Let’s say two competing AC Repair companies (ABC & XYZ) are striving to be the top on Google’s search when a customer searches for “AC Repair”.  Company ABC is willing to pay $10 for the click to their website and has a quality score of 3 giving them a ranking score of 30.  Company XYZ is willing to pay $4 for the click to their website and has a quality score of 10 giving them a ranking score of 40.  Company XYZ would show up first on Google and would not pay the full $4 for the click to their website.  Company ABC would need to increase their max spend to $13.34 to show up on top of company XYZ.

Quality Score is everything.  Many factors including website design, landing page and relevant keyword choices play an important role in quality score.

Google Adwords is “non-organic” where advertisers and business can advertise their company on the paid section of Google search engine and partners using a pay-per-click or pay-per-impression type model.  It includes the ads at top and on the side of Google, banner ads on partner websites and also includes radio and TV advertising.
